Alkyd Resins

For various architectural and industrial air-drying and baking enamels — lift-resistant primers for lacquer systems, fast-drying industrial enamels, metal primers, traffic paints, tin coatings, drum enamels, marine paints, spar varnishes, floor coatings, etc. As plasticizer for lacquers.

PURE ALKYD RESIN

Short Oil Coconut Alkyd

For durable high gloss baking enamels. Used as a plasticizing resin for nitrocellulose and vinyl resins. Typical applications include automotive enamels and lacquers, furniture lacquers, enamels for metal equipment and fixtures.

Medium Linseed Alkyd

Offers excellent adhesion, flexibility and durability. Exhibits good drying properties. Produces paint film with good gloss retention. Recommended for industrial air-dry and baking enamels, automotive and machinery enamels, industrial metal primers.

Medium Soya Alkyd

Provides enamels with good adhesion, gloss and flexibility. Designed for architectural and industrial enamels. Different grades are available with varying viscosities to suit different needs.

Long Oil Soya Alkyd

Recommended for interior and exterior enamels, marine finishes, sign paints, and the manufacture of pigment pastes. Could also be used for silkscreen inks.

MODIFIED ALKYD RESIN

Rosin and Phenolic – Modified Short Oil Linseed Alkyd

Provides coatings with fast-drying property, unusually good adhesion, excellent hardness and durability. For fast-drying industrial enamels, e.g., marine and furniture enamels, traffic paints. Grades are available for making lift-resistant primers and surfacers for lacquer systems.

Styrenated Alkyd-Acrylic Resin

Has outstanding combination of hardness and flexibility, good adhesion and toughness, good color and gloss retention even on overbaking. Recommended for use as sole vehicle or as an amino resin modified vehicle for roller, strip or coil coating of thin metals for cans, caps, closures and other formed articles.

Rosin-Modified Medium Soya

High viscosity grades are available to permit formulations of low solid cost-effective enamels at normal package consistency. Have outstanding drying characteristics and good pigment- wetting property. Recommended for cost-effective fast-dry enamels, traffic paints, shop coat primers, and economical drum coatings. May also be used as a modifier for pure oxidizing and modified alkyds to speed up drying and improve gloss.

Urethane-Modified Long Oil Soya

Provides fast-drying varnishes with excellent abrasion resistance, good color and color retention, excellent leveling, and outstanding resistance to household chemicals and solvents.
